#dc3d4e basic color information

#dc3d4e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#dc3d4e has decimal index of: 14433614, is composed of 86.3% red, 23.9% green and 30.6% blue. #dc3d4e in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 72.3% magenta, 64.5% yellow and 13.7% black.
#cc3366 is the closest web-safe color to #dc3d4e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
